Has anyone tested text-to-CAD tools for quick concept modeling of enclosures? I’m designing a small plastic enclosure for a PCB-based sensor module (around 60x40x20 mm) and was wondering if any of the new text-to-CAD AI tools could help speed up early-stage conception—just basic geometry, mounting bosses, snap-fit features, and some ventilation slots. I don’t expect full manufacturable parts, but something good enough to clean up in Fusion or SolidWorks.

      First up, my answer below may be outdated within a matter of weeks or months. At the rate that consumer AI tools have been developing, it will only be a matter of time before there is a new update from one of the many tools that become the new benchmark in capability. There are already a few text-to-CAD tools that can get close to what you’re looking for, and they’ll only get better from here!

      I think you need to be sure about the file type that the tool will generate for you – judging from your question, I think a STEP file is probably best for compatibility across packages. For this reason, I’d suggest you use Zoo.dev. neThing.xyz is another option, but you may need a premium tier.

        The best user experience I’ve seen with text-CAD is Adam CAD. It provides the various parameters for adjusting the details of the model that’s been generated.
